The Drug Discovery Services Market is poised for significant growth driven by several key factors. The increasing prevalence of chronic diseases, such as cancer, diabetes, and neurological disorders, is prompting demand for novel therapeutic solutions. As pharmaceutical companies seek to develop innovative drugs to address these health challenges, they are increasingly turning to specialized service providers for support throughout the drug discovery process. The acceleration of research and development activities, bolstered by advancements in biotechnology and the integration of artificial intelligence in research methodologies, is also contributing to market expansion. Enhanced computational models and machine learning algorithms are streamlining drug design and optimizing lead identification, consequently reducing time to market for new therapeutics.
The rise of personalized medicine presents another enticing opportunity within the drug discovery arena. As more patients seek tailored treatment options based on their genetic profiles, there is a growing need for service providers who can facilitate the development of targeted therapies. Moreover, the collaboration between academia and industry is fostering innovation and enabling the translation of research findings into viable drug candidates. Partnerships between pharmaceutical companies and biotechnology firms are becoming increasingly common, allowing for resource sharing and improved success rates in drug development. Additionally, regulatory support for outsourcing drug discovery services is encouraging smaller biotech firms to seek external expertise, further fueling market growth.

Despite the positive outlook for the Drug Discovery Services Market, several constraints may hinder its progress. One of the fundamental challenges is the high cost associated with drug discovery activities. The complexity and unpredictability of the drug development process can lead to significant financial investments, making it difficult for smaller companies and startups to compete. Additionally, there are often lengthy timelines involved in drug approval, which can dissuade potential investors from committing capital to early-stage drug development.
Another notable restraint is the regulatory landscape, which can vary significantly across different regions and countries. Navigating these regulations can be cumbersome and time-consuming, potentially causing delays in research and commercialization efforts. The industry's reliance on outsourcing also creates dependency risks, as companies must carefully choose partners to ensure quality and compliance with regulatory standards. Furthermore, the emergence of generic drugs and biosimilars poses a threat to the profitability of novel treatments, pressuring companies to innovate continually and enhance their offerings to stay competitive in a crowded marketplace. These factors present ongoing challenges that stakeholders in the drug discovery services sector must navigate to achieve long-term success.

Type
The Drug Discovery Services Market can be broadly categorized into various types, including Preclinical Services, Clinical Services, and Others. Among these, Preclinical Services is anticipated to capture a significant market share due to the crucial role it plays in the initial phases of drug development. This segment encompasses in vitro and in vivo testing, toxicology, and pharmacokinetics, which are fundamental to determining the safety and efficacy of new compounds. Clinical Services are also expected to experience robust growth, driven by the increasing demand for clinical trial management services and patient recruitment strategies. The focus on personalized medicine is further enhancing the need for more specialized drug discovery services, making this segment one of the fastest-growing areas in the market.
Process
The processes involved in drug discovery can generally be categorized into Target Identification, Hit-to-Lead, Lead Optimization, Preclinical, and Clinical Development. Target Identification has gained prominence due to advancements in genomics and proteomics that facilitate the discovery of novel drug targets. The Hit-to-Lead and Lead Optimization phases are crucial for refining potential drug candidates and are expected to experience substantial growth as companies seek to enhance the efficiency of their R&D pipelines. The Preclinical phase remains significant as it bridges the gap between laboratory experiments and clinical trials, while the Clinical Development phase is witnessing rapid expansion thanks to an increase in clinical trial activities and regulatory reforms aimed at expediting drug approvals.
Drug Type
The market also segments drug types into Small Molecules, Biologics, and Others. Small Molecules hold a considerable portion of the market due to their established role in treating a variety of diseases, including cancer and cardiovascular disorders. However, Biologics are anticipated to demonstrate the fastest growth owing to the increasing prevalence of chronic diseases and advancements in biotechnology. The focus on monoclonal antibodies, gene therapies, and cell therapies drives the expansion of this segment, particularly as they become integral components of modern medical treatment strategies.
Therapeutic Area
Therapeutic areas within the Drug Discovery Services Market include Oncology, Neurology, Cardiovascular, Infectious Diseases, and Others. Oncology is expected to maintain the largest market size as it continues to be a focal point for drug development, driven by the high incidence rates of cancer globally and the need for innovative therapies. Neurology is projected to experience the fastest growth due to the rising prevalence of neurodegenerative disorders such as Alzheimer's and Parkinson's diseases, prompting significant investment in novel treatments. Infectious diseases, particularly in the wake of global health crises, are also gaining attention, driving both research and funding into effective drug discovery efforts.
